A Chinese Wanli style Blue and White Jar, Qing dynasty of broad ovoid form with a short slightly convex neck, the body decorated with a continuous scene of birds amidst pine trees and bamboo with an irregular scrolling type design at the top perhaps intended to depict mountains, the shoulder with panels of birds and flowers on a fish scale ground, the neck with small floral sprays of plantain leaves, the base unglazed and countersunk. The style of decoration and the blue follow the well known designs of the Wan Li period (1573-1619) but the shape of the piece and the paste and finish of the footrim suggest a circa date of a later period, perhaps towards the end of the eighteenth century." Ht 21.6cm; Width (max) 28cm Good condition with no restoration; glaze scratches to the surface. View on auctionatrium.com
